Full facsimile of the original edition, not reproduced with Optical Recognition software. Originally published in 1872, the greater part of the novel consists of a description of Erewhon. The nature of this nation is intended to be ambiguous. At first glance, Erewhon appears to be a Utopia, yet it soon becomes clear that this is far from the case. Yet for all the failings of Erewhon, it is also clearly not a dystopia, such as that depicted in George Orwell's Nineteen Eighty-Four. As a satirical utopia, \u003cem\u003eErewhon\u003c\/em\u003e has sometimes been compared to \u003cem\u003eGulliver's Travels\u003c\/em\u003e (1726), a classic novel by Jonathan Swift; the image of Utopia in this latter case also bears strong parallels with the self-view of the British Empire at the time. It can also be compared to the William Morris novel, \u003cem\u003eNews from Nowhere\u003c\/em\u003e.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e \u003cem\u003eErewhon\u003c\/em\u003e satirizes various aspects of Victorian society, including criminal punishment, religion and anthropocentrism. For example, according to Erewhonian law, offenders are treated as if they were ill, whereas ill people are looked upon as criminals. Another feature of \u003cem\u003eErewhon\u003c\/em\u003e is the absence of machines; this is due to the widely shared perception by the Erewhonians that they are potentially dangerous. Inspired by Samuel Butler's years in colonial New Zealand and by his reading of Darwin's \u003cem\u003eOrigin of Species\u003c\/em\u003e, \u003cem\u003eErewhon\u003c\/em\u003e is a highly original, irreverent and humorous satire on conventional virtues, religious hypocrisy and the unthinking acceptance of beliefs.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e \u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"US \/ WELL_READ \/ SBYB","offer_id":50371519283473,"sku":"CIN1082507644A","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false},{"title":"US \/ GOOD \/ SBYB","offer_id":50371523936529,"sku":"CIN1082507644G","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/1082507644.jpg?v=1786182071"},{"product_id":"iliad-book-samuel-butler-9781453772942","title":"The Iliad","description":"November 13, 2014, changed my life forever. By","description":null,"br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"- \/ - \/ -","offer_id":51385481363729,"sku":"","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true},{"title":"US \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":51385482707217,"sku":"NIN9781540694171","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/1540694178.jpg?v=1750760911"},{"product_id":"erewhon-or-over-the-range-the-1872-satirical-literary-classic-annotated-book-samuel-butler-9798396758742","title":"Erewhon: Or, Over the Range: The 1872 Satirical Literary Classic (Annotated)","description":null,"br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"GB \/ VERY_GOOD \/ INTERNAL","offer_id":52110313095441,"sku":"GOR013950449","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/9798396758742.jpg?v=1757133539"},{"product_id":"life-and-habit-book-samuel-butler-9781108005517","title":"Life and Habit","description":"I cannot think that natural selection, working upon small, fortuitous, indefinite, unintelligent variations, would produce the results we see around us. One wants something that will give a more definite aim to variations, and hence, at times, cause bolder leaps in advance. One cannot but doubt whether so many plants and animals would be being so continually saved by the skin of their teeth. -from Lamarck and Mr. Darwin George Bernard Shaw called him the greatest English writer of the latter half of the nineteenth century. Samuel Butler, the son of an Anglican clergyman who grew up to be one of the most prominent freethinkers of the Victorian era, was a vocal apologist for theism, and his Life and Habit, published in 1877, is a beautifully written critique of Charles Darwin and his theory of natural selection, one that laments its lack of call for a creative mind behind the evolution of life. This is a vital work for appreciating Butler's other criticisms of scientific rationalism, including his 1879 book Evolution, Old and New, as well as the evolution of the concept of evolution itself. Samuel Butler (4th December 1835 - 18th June 1902) had both a father and grandfather in the church and was being groomed by his father to be a priest. However, after a first at Cambridge, he decided he wanted to be an artist. His father could not and would not consider such a thing and by mutual consent Samuel went to New Zealand to be a sheep farmer. Here he started writing which he continued on his return to London as well as taking up painting. Whilst he did have several paintings exhibited at the Royal Academy, his talent undoubtably was in his writing but the extent of which was only really apparent after his death. This was due entirely to his great work, The Way of All Flesh published the year after he died to tumultuous acclaim which is well illustrated by George Bernard Shaw describing it as one of the summits of human achievement. The Way of All Flesh is a thinly disguised autobiographical account of his own harsh Christian upbringing as it traces the life and loves of Ernest Pontifex and his family. Along the way, it satires Victorian values and beliefs and with brilliant wit and irony offers a powerful indictment of most 19th-century institutions in England. Each generation has found that despite the book savaging Victorian hypocrisy, it still speaks to every era as ultimately the theme of young people growing up wanting a greater degree of personal freedom than their parents is very much alive and kicking in most families around the world.","br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"GB \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":52655481422097,"sku":"NLS9781434456595","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true},{"title":"US \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":52749329989905,"sku":"NIN9781434456595","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/9781434456595.jpg?v=1762220822"},{"product_id":"authoress-of-the-odyssey-by-book-samuel-butler-9781717298096","title":"The Authoress of the Odyssey By","description":null,"br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"- \/ - \/ INTERNAL","offer_id":52753932910865,"sku":null,"price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true},{"title":"US \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":52753933500689,"sku":"NIN9781717298096","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/9781717298096.jpg?v=1763567784"},{"product_id":"samuel-butler-s-the-way-of-all-flesh-book-samuel-butler-9781780009001","title":"Samuel Butler's The Way Of All Flesh","description":"Sensible people get the greater part of their dying done during their own lifetime. It has traditionally been read as a male story: the saga of one man’s heroic struggle against supernatural enemies and the threat of a violent death.\u003cbr\u003e\n\u003cbr\u003e\nBut in 1900, the author and classical scholar Samuel Butler published a prose translation of The Odyssey that presented a very different picture.\u003cbr\u003e\n\u003cbr\u003e\nAccording to Butler, the poem’s repeated borrowings from Homer’s other poem, The Iliad, suggested that The Odyssey must be a later and deferential work. By extension, he said, it must also be by a different author. And when he looked at the language of the poem and its themes, he concluded that the author must have been a woman: specifically, a young, unmarried woman living near Trapani, in western Sicily. He went further, proposing that the author had written herself into the poem as Nausikaa, the Phaiakian princess who encounters the shipwrecked Odysseus by the shore.\u003cbr\u003e\n\u003cbr\u003e\nButler’s translation and notes appeared at a historic moment in our culture, alongside the arrival of the New Woman and the growing campaign for women’s suffrage. Whether he welcomed such developments or indeed the consequences of his own theory is debatable. There are places where he seems frustrated by his conclusions: that this legendary masculine epic might be the product of a female imagination.\u003cbr\u003e\n\u003cbr\u003e\nHis fellow critics scorned him for his literalism—his insistence that the text of The Odyssey could be taken at face value—and for what we would now call his gender stereotyping. Yet even if Butler’s analysis was unsound in some respects, he may still have noticed something in The Odyssey that generations of earlier readers had overlooked.\u003cbr\u003e\n\u003cbr\u003e\nPublished three years after his study The Authoress of The Odyssey, this translation shows Butler engaged in an Odyssean struggle of his own: the attempt to come to terms with a proposition that troubled him but which was entirely original and which he wholly believed in. \u003cbr\u003e\n\u003cbr\u003e\nWelcome to the Butler edition of The Odyssey.\u003cbr\u003e\n\u003cbr\u003e\nWith a new Preface and Introduction by Stephen Games.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"GB \/ NEW \/ GARDNERS","offer_id":54105959334161,"sku":"NGR9781915023889","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false}]},{"product_id":"authoress-of-the-odyssey-book-samuel-butler-9781915023896","title":"The Authoress of The Odyssey","description":"\u003cp\u003e\u003cem\u003eThe Authoress of The Odyssey\u003c\/em\u003e is one of the most controversial books to emerge from the Humanities. The questions it raises challenge not only how we read Classical literature but how we judge flawed thinkers-today's as well as those in the past.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eMore than a century before the rise of today's Cancel Culture, author and polymath Samuel Butler—who famously predicted Artificial Intelligence while working as a sheep farmer in 1863—brought a radical and original intelligence to bear on Homer's epics. In the face of opposition and mockery, he concluded that the author of The Odyssey was a young woman—\"single and headstrong\".\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eIn \u003cem\u003eThe Authoress\u003c\/em\u003e, Butler lays out his argument step by step, challenging readers with his sharp rationalism while provoking them with prejudices reflective of his culture and troubled background. \u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eButler regarded his results as unarguable and thought equally highly of his own genius. He was not pleased, however, by where his logic had led him. What he saw as evidence of female authorship struck him also as evidence of artistic inadequacy. The Authoress therefore became both a hatchet job on one of our civilisation's most revered texts and a test case in Victorian misogyny.\u003cbr\u003e\n\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eFrom a distance of more than 125 years, it is easy to dismiss Butler's findings as no less distasteful than his biases. And yet, despite his flaws, The Authoress pioneered the analytical paradigm of Practical Criticism that would dominate literary inquiry at the highest level for the next half-century.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eIn that context, The Authoress forces us to confront an urgent and topical moral dilemma now haunting academia: how do we avoid shutting down difficult ideas because we dislike their source?\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"- \/ - \/ INTERNAL","offer_id":54106538901777,"sku":null,"price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true},{"title":"GB \/ NEW \/ GARDNERS","offer_id":54106539229457,"sku":"NGR9781915023896","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/9781915023896.jpg?v=1786183457"},{"product_id":"hudibras-part-1-3-book-samuel-butler-9781015755840","title":"Hudibras, Part 1-3","description":"Title: Hudibras, in three parts .
